Edmonton Capitals Game Time Change & Autograph Session
May 15, 2009 - Golden Baseball League (GBL)
Edmonton Capitals News Release
Edmonton, AB - Due to the impending inclement weather expected for the Calgary region, the Edmonton Capitals exhibition game versus the Calgary Vipers Monday May 18th has been re-scheduled for Sunday May 17th. Game time will be 3 p.m. at Calgary's Foothills Stadium.
Meanwhile, Edmonton baseball fans are invited to meet some members of the team that they will be cheering for starting May 21st. The Edmonton Capitals will be hosting an informal meet and greet at the Edmonton Valley Zoo. All fans are invited to collect autographs, ask questions, and take pictures.
Who: Edmonton Capitals Baseball Team
What: Autograph Session
Where: Edmonton Valley Zoo, directly inside the gates. The event will be moved indoors at the zoo if the weather doesn't permit an outside function.
When: Sunday, May 17th (12 p.m. -1 p.m.)
The inaugural season of the Edmonton Capitals kicks of on Thursday, May 21st at 7:00pm. Tickets are available at the new Telus Field Box Office, at any Ticketmaster location or on-line at capsbaseball.ca.
